EKSctl: Difference between revisions
Jump to navigation
Jump to search
No edit summary |
No edit summary |
||
Line 4: | Line 4: | ||
SUM_SUFFIX=$(curl -sL "https://github.com/eksctl-io/eksctl/releases/latest/download/eksctl_checksums.txt"|grep ${PLATFORM}) | SUM_SUFFIX=$(curl -sL "https://github.com/eksctl-io/eksctl/releases/latest/download/eksctl_checksums.txt"|grep ${PLATFORM}) | ||
cat << EXE | bash | cat << EXE|bash | ||
cd ${HOME}/Downloads | cd ${HOME}/Downloads | ||
echo ${SUM_SUFFIX}|sha256sum --check | echo ${SUM_SUFFIX}|sha256sum --check | ||
Line 11: | Line 11: | ||
EXE | EXE | ||
cat << EXE |sudo bash | cat << EXE|sudo bash | ||
cd ${HOME}/Downloads | cd ${HOME}/Downloads | ||
mv eksctl /usr/local/bin | mv eksctl /usr/local/bin |
Revision as of 20:55, 22 July 2024
PLATFORM=$(uname -s)_$(dpkg --print-architecture)
wget -cq https://github.com/eksctl-io/eksctl/releases/latest/download/eksctl_${PLATFORM}.tar.gz -P ${HOME}/Downloads
SUM_SUFFIX=$(curl -sL "https://github.com/eksctl-io/eksctl/releases/latest/download/eksctl_checksums.txt"|grep ${PLATFORM})
cat << EXE|bash
cd ${HOME}/Downloads
echo ${SUM_SUFFIX}|sha256sum --check
tar -xzf eksctl_${PLATFORM}.tar.gz
rm -rf eksctl_${PLATFORM}.tar.gz
EXE
cat << EXE|sudo bash
cd ${HOME}/Downloads
mv eksctl /usr/local/bin
EXE
Playground
| ||
References
| ||